The Santa Fe Christian Eagles will head out on the road to take on the Coastal Academy Stingrays at 4:00 p.m. on Wednesday. Santa Fe Christian will be coming into the matchup with an undefeated record on the line.
Coastal Academy's hitters are going to have their work cut out for them on Wednesday: Santa Fe Christian had not allowed a single run the last three times they've hit the field. Santa Fe Christian came out on top against Maranatha Christian by a score of 4-0 on Friday.
Olivia Anderson was a major factor while hitting and pitching. She didn't allow a single earned run and only one hit while striking out seven over five innings pitched. Anderson was also big at the plate, scoring two runs and stealing a base.
In other batting news, Maya Tyszkiewicz was excellent, scoring two runs and stealing two bases while going 1-for-2. Another player making a difference was Bryn Henson, who went 2-for-3 with a double and an RBI.
Meanwhile, Coastal Academy sure made it a nail-biter, but they managed to escape with a 9-8 victory over Tri-City Christian on Friday.
Like Santa Fe Christian, Coastal Academy also got a great game from a two-way player: Sofia Tillis. She looked comfortable on the mound, striking out 12 batters over seven innings while giving up just one earned (and seven unearned) runs off four hits. Tillis was also solid in the batter's box, scoring a run while going 1-for-2.
In other batting news, Aubrey Price was a standout: she scored a run and stole a base while getting on base in three of her five plate appearances. Delylah Ordman was another key contributor, scoring two runs and stealing two bases while getting on base in four of her five plate appearances.
Santa Fe Christian pushed their record up to 12-0-1 with that win, which was their 12th straight at home dating back to last season. As for Coastal Academy, they have been performing incredibly well recently as they've won six of their last seven matches, which provided a massive bump to their 10-10 record this season.
Wednesday's game will be a test for both team's pitchers. Santa Fe Christian hasn't had any issues making contact this season, having earned a batting average of .358. However, it's not like Coastal Academy struggles in that department as they've averaged .344. With both teams so capable at the plate, fans should be ready for an impressive hitting performance.
